The full list of early entries in the 2013 NFL draft is out, and here are a few things about it that caught our eye:

-- Two Texas A&M players, defensive end Damontre Moore and offensive tackle Luke Joeckel, have a chance of being the two first players taken. Other early entries who look like Top 5 picks include LSU defensive end Barkevious Mingo and Georgia outside linebacker Jarvis Jones.

-- Only one quarterback, Tennessee’s Tyler Bray, is on the list. Bray has a big arm but questionable decision making and is likely to go no higher than third in a fairly weak quarterback class, definitely after seniors Geno Smith of West Virginia and Matt Barkley of USC and possibly after Mike Glennon of North Carolina State, Ryan Nassib of Syracuse and Tyler Wilson of Arkansas.

-- The positions break down like this:
15 defensive backs
12 running backs
10 wide receivers
9 defensive tackles/nose tackles
8 defensive ends
6 linebackers
5 tight ends
4 offensive tackles
1 quarterback
1 center
1 guard
1 punter

-- A whopping 11 early entries are from LSU. Coach Les Miles recruits a lot of talent, and this year he’s losing a lot of talent.
